What each one is

The product in its own terms, so the numbers below have context.

Parallels RAS

A platform that enables IT administrators to deploy and deliver Windows applications and virtual desktops to users across on-premises data centers, private clouds, and public cloud environments. Supports multiple hypervisors and cloud providers without vendor lock-in, and clients are available across Windows, macOS, Linux, iOS, Android, and web browsers.

ThinLinc

A server-based computing solution that allows organizations to centrally host Linux desktops and applications in data centers or cloud environments, delivering secure remote access to end users through native clients or web browsers.

ThinLinc

SubscriptionFree tier

Free tier up to 10 users. Commercial subscriptions available with tiered pricing; no prices published online—contact sales.

  • Community LicenseFree
  • ThinLinc SubscriptionContact sales
    • Support from Cendio technical team
    • Product upgrades and new versions
  • ThinLinc Premium SubscriptionContact sales
    • Prioritized support responses
    • Faster response times
    • Direct telephone support
